WebReduce the Number and Frequency of Errors Mitigate the Consequences When an Error does Occur What is Human Performance? 75% - 80% of all OSHA recordable injuries … Web1. The most common causes of human errors include lack of training, poor communication, fatigue, stress, distractions, and faulty equipment. 2. Most errors occur during routine tasks (when the operator is overconfident) or while performing complex ones (when the operator does not have the necessary skills and tools). 3. WebHuman error is rarely random. •It is connected to the tools, tasks and environment. That is, it can often be predicted, and in some situations, is inevitable. People want to do the right … WebEliminating paper is key to reducing human error. By transitioning to a modern MES, manufacturers can reduce costs, improve efficiency, streamline compliance, and reduce or eliminate errors that cause delays. For example, with the use of EBRs, much of the process is automated, and the potential for human error declines significantly.
